In this video we look at a hair growth cleanser that is packed full of ayurvedic herbs known to stimulate growth. This means that when your hair is at it's wet and weakest you can strengthen and nourish instead of stripping it.

I have been experimenting with cleansing ayurvedic powders like shikakai, aritha, and neem. I will sometimes add amla or zizyphus/sidr. I like the cleansing benefits of the mix but I do find that it can be too strengthening so I don't manipulate my hair until after I applied a conditioning mask or treatment. I also have to be very careful because I find that the mix can get into my eyes. I love zizphus/sidr as a conditioning mask on its own. It is not strengthening at all on my hair. It actually imparts moisture. I prefer to use it as a conditioning mask because it doesn't seem to cleanse as well as the other powders on my hair.
